UTEP Raises $41.5 Million in FY25, Topping $40M for Fourth Year in A Row

Funds support scholarships engineering, athletics, science and hundreds of other programs

EL PASO, Texas (Oct. 21, 2025) – More that 6,428 donors gave $41,558,827 to support the mission of The University of Texas at El Paso during UTEP’s 2025 Fiscal Year, which ended August 31. This is the fourth year in a row that giving to UTEP has topped $40 million.

“We are deeply grateful to the thousands of friends of UTEP who support our students and our mission,” said UTEP President Heather Wilson. “Our donors help us change lives and advance knowledge. We couldn’t do nearly as much without them.”

Scholarships, mining engineering, science, athletics and computer science were UTEP programs that received some of the largest gifts in FY25. In total, donors made 17,162 unique gifts to 514 supported programs and projects. More than 1,900 individuals were first time donors to UTEP last year.

“I am proud of the work that UTEP’s advancement team did this year, helping to connect giving opportunities to our generous donors,” said Gary Edens, Ed.D., interim vice president of institutional advancement. “From small ones to large ones, every gift makes a difference.”

Gifts under $25,000 made up $5.2 million of the FY25 total. Major gifts, or gifts above $25,000 and less than $1 million totaled $13.6 million. Principle gifts, or gifts over $1 million, totaled $22.8 million.

 

About The University of Texas at El Paso

The University of Texas at El Paso is America’s leading Hispanic-serving university. Located at the westernmost tip of Texas, where three states and two countries converge along the Rio Grande, 84% of our 26,000 students are Hispanic, and more than half are the first in their families to go to college. UTEP offers 171 bachelor’s, master’s and doctoral degree programs at the only open-access, top-tier research university in America.
